REPORT DATE: 03-07-2024 REPORT TIME: 0558 UTC REGION: PACIFIC SUB REGION: MARIANA ISLANDS AREA/BLOCK: N/A IMAGE DATE: 03-07-2024 IMAGE TIME: 0052 UTC DATA SOURCE: SENTINEL2A MODE: Multispectral RESOLUTION: 10 meter LOCATION: 17°37'34" N/146°13'49" E AREA: 0.34 square kilometers CONFIDENCE: Medium REPORT MAP/GIS FILES: https://www.ospo.noaa.gov/Products/ocean/marinepollution/ Possible oil was observed in satellite imagery. This anomaly is unconfirmed as oil. The area of oil measured approximately 1.62nm in length and up to 0.8nm in width. The area appeared darker than its surroundings in satellite imagery and had a well-defined edge. The area also exhibited some feathering features along the southeastern side. Winds were approximately 5kts from the West at the time of the imagery. Due to these factors, our confidence level is Medium.
